Y1 - 2019 N1 - T2 - Katzung & Trevor's Pharmacology: Examination & Board Review, 12e AB - Pharmacokinetics denotes the effects of biologic systems on drugs. The major processes involved in pharmacokinetics are absorption, distribution, and elimination. Appropriate application of pharmacokinetic data and a few simple formulas makes it possible to calculate loading and maintenance doses. Various diseases can modify the standard “average” pharmacokinetic parameters. Adjustment of the dosage for a specific patient can be calculated if that patient’s pharmacokinetic parameters are known.
